Enriches the lives of young children and their families by providing opportunities for learning, creativity, exploration, and curiosity. The school is inspired by the principles of the Reggio Emilia approach. The belief is that all children are competent learners, ready to explore their environments, engage in social interactions and construct their own learning. Play is essential to early learning because it offers opportunities for children to build relationships with other children, with materials and with their environment. Family engagement opportunities, including parent education workshops and individual counseling are also integral parts of the  program.

The preschool is infused with Judaic values and culture. Classroom experiences are guided by Jewish holidays and traditions, including a weekly all-school Shabbat and Havdalah rituals. By living our Jewish values, sharing stories, singing songs, cooking and celebrating the Jewish holidays together, the school helps make Judaism a meaningful part of each family’s life.
